Kangaroo tries to drown dog, attacks owner
From Associated Press
November 23, 2009 8:57 AM EST

MELBOURNE, Australia - A kangaroo startled by a man walking his dog attacked the pair, pinning the pet underwater and slashing the owner in the abdomen with its hind legs.
